Luxembourg City's Begging Ban: Displacing Poverty, Not Solving It
Luxembourg City banned begging in December 2023, shifting beggars to the city's outskirts and sparking debate on poverty in this wealthy nation where over 20% of the population is at risk of poverty, despite city efforts to provide food and shelter.

Spanish Garbage Collection Costs Vary Widely, New Law to Impact Costs
An OCU report reveals that the annual cost of garbage collection in Spain varies widely, from €27.60 in Soria to €202.05 in San Sebastián, with an average of €84.64. This disparity is expected to change with the implementation of a new waste law in April 2025.

SAT Offers Payment Plans and Penalty Reductions for 2024 Tax Liabilities
The Mexican tax authority (SAT) offers taxpayers facing 2024 tax liabilities payment plans with up to 36 installments and potential 100% penalty reductions, accessible online or in person until December 31, 2024.
